Tennessee Judge Dismisses Miley Cyrus Parentage Suit With Prejudice, Awards Billy Ray Cyrus Fees

A dismissal with prejudice ends Jayme Lee’s claims, with the court awarding Billy Ray Cyrus recovery of his attorney’s fees.

Overview

  • The Davidson County Circuit Court dismissed the case on December 5 with prejudice, closing the matter permanently and awarding Billy Ray Cyrus recovery of reasonable attorney’s fees and costs.
  • Plaintiff Jayme Lee alleged she gave birth to Miley Cyrus at age 12 and described a supposed private adoption agreement that included naming rights and work as a nanny and piano teacher.
  • A judge previously denied Lee’s request for a trial in October after she sought supervised DNA maternity and paternity testing of Miley and her parents.
  • Billy Ray Cyrus moved to dismiss all claims on November 20 and filed a December 1 response opposing the amended complaint, calling the allegations false, absurd, and intended to harass his family.
  • With the dismissal, Lee cannot refile the same claims, and the amount of recoverable legal fees will be determined through a separate process.
